Direct Variation: If y = 12, when x = 4, find y when x = 20. a.40 b.48 c.12 d.60

Answer:

d

Step-by-step explanation:

Given the x and y are in direct variation then the equation relating them is

y = kx ← k is the constant of variation

To find k use the condition y = 12 when x = 4, that is

12 = 4k ( divide both sides by 4 )

3 = k

y = 3k ← equation of variation

When x = 20 , then

y = 3 × 20 = 60 → d
